#9db9f1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9db9f1 is composed of 61.6% red, 72.5%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.9% cyan, 23.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 220 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 78%. #9db9f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3b73e3.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#9db9f1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9db9f1 has RGB values of R:157, G:185,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 10336753.

Shades and Tints of #9db9f1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f3f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9db9f1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4c6ca is the less saturated color, while #90b5fe is the most saturated one.
